With over a decade of legal experience, Kathryn provides comprehensive support to clients on all aspects of their real estate and business matters. She graduated Cum Laude from Manchester University in 2010 and from Indiana University Robert H. McKinney School of Law in 2013.
Kathryn delivers tailored solutions to individuals, businesses, universities, and municipalities. From navigating the intricacies of business contracts to negotiating property transfers and facilitating smooth closings, she works collaboratively with clients, title companies, and financial institutions to draft essential documents and to find solutions for pressing needs. She offers expert guidance on various issues such as easements, eminent domain, variances, zoning, quiet title actions, lease agreements, real property acquisitions and sales, commercial contracts, and business formation documents.
Her practical and solution-oriented approach ensures clients receive strategic guidance and efficient representation.
Kathryn is a licensed title insurance agent, trained civil mediator, and registered family law mediator. She currently serves on the boards of the Little Blessings Childcare Ministry and the Lafontaine Arts Council. Residing in Huntington, Indiana, Kathryn enjoys traveling, running, music and theater, and spending time with family. She is a member of the Allen County, Huntington County, Indiana State, and American Bar Associations.
